                               if the outside defects are under the glaze then the ceramic has had its final firing and all should be fine. They were probably bits of clay not brushed off after moulding and then fell off during the first firing leaving pock marks.

    The ragged edges inside are also cosmetic and should not cause any problems, its poor quality control when cleaning the "green" clay after moulding and all mould lines are trimmed off.

    But if you are unhappy with the appearance and lets face it despite being 40% the cost of a BGE or KamadoJoe this is still 350 quid you have spent, then you have the right to a replacement or money back.
